Criminal Justice Act 2003 SCHEDULE 16

1–2222 provisions

1

Rape.

2

Clandestine injury to women.

3

Abduction of woman or girl with intent to rape or ravish.

4

Assault with intent to rape or ravish.

5

Indecent assault.

6

Lewd, indecent or libidinous behaviour or practices.

7

Shameless indecency.

8

Sodomy.

9

An offence under section 170 of the Customs and Excise Management Act 1979 (c. 2) in relation to goods prohibited to be imported under section 42 of the Customs Consolidation Act 1876 (c. 36), but only where the prohibited goods include indecent photographs of persons.

10

An offence under section 52 of the Civic Government (Scotland) Act 1982 (c. 45) (taking and distribution of indecent images of children).

11

An offence under section 52A of that Act (possession of indecent images of children).

12

An offence under section 1 of the Criminal Law (Consolidation) (Scotland) Act 1995 (c. 39) (incest).

13

An offence under section 2 of that Act (intercourse with a stepchild).

14

An offence under section 3 of that Act (intercourse with child under 16 by person in position of trust).

15

An offence under section 5 of that Act (unlawful intercourse with girl under 16).

16

An offence under section 6 of that Act (indecent behaviour towards girl between 12 and 16).

17

An offence under section 8 of that Act (detention of woman in brothel or other premises).

18

An offence under section 10 of that Act (person having parental responsibilities causing or encouraging sexual activity in relation to a girl under 16).

19

An offence under subsection (5) of section 13 of that Act (homosexual offences).

20

An offence under section 3 of the Sexual Offences (Amendment) Act 2000 (c. 44) (abuse of position of trust).

21

An offence of— (a) attempting, conspiring or inciting another to commit any offence specified in the preceding paragraphs, or (b) aiding, abetting, counselling or procuring the commission of any offence specified in paragraphs 9 to 20.

22

Any offence (other than an offence specified in any of the preceding paragraphs) inferring personal violence.
